site stats

Dijkstra algorithm js

WebDijkstra algorithm implemented in JS. Contribute to zDogemon/dijkstra-algorithm development by creating an account on GitHub. WebMar 28, 2024 · Dijkstra’s algorithm is a popular algorithms for solving many single-source shortest path problems having non-negative edge weight in the graphs i.e., it is to find …

Dijkstra

WebJan 26, 2024 · Step 1 : Add nodes to the map by clicking on specific points. Enable a node to be created when you click on a specific point. map.on ('click', function (e) { var node = []; node [0] = e.latlng.lat; node [1] = e.latlng.lng; addNodes (node,curr_node); }); You have to create a textarea so that the necessary variables can be printed on for you to ... WebMay 2, 2024 · 1. I tried to add Dijkstra's algorithm to a js game. First when I got it working it was very very Laggy (5-10 fps) and the browser would crash.. After adding a lot more improvements I got it to like 50-60 fps with 200 tiles (see GRID_SPREADING in script bellow). When I turn off this algorithm I have 120-144 fps, but I am trying to at least get ... mini four climadiff c610ncntb https://desdoeshairnyc.com

Dijkstra

WebMar 1, 2024 · Printing Paths in Dijkstra’s Shortest Path Algorithm. Given a graph and a source vertex in the graph, find the shortest paths from the source to all vertices in the given graph. We have discussed Dijkstra’s … WebDijkstra's algorithm can be used to find the shortest path on both directed and undirected graphs due to its greedy strategy. Dijkstra's algorithm can be implemented by … WebAlgorithm 链路状态路由协议——Dijkstras算法 algorithm networking 当你为R3做Dijkstra算法时,我知道你首先要加上N3和N4,然后看看成本,2小于4,所以N4变成永久性的,但是当N4变成永久性的时候,它会加上R4和R7吗? mini four carrefour soldes

Dijkstra

Category:How to implement Dijkstra’s Algorithm in JavaScript

Tags:Dijkstra algorithm js

Dijkstra algorithm js

Dijkstra’s Algorithm in JavaScript by Regina Furness Medium

http://duoduokou.com/algorithm/50807986733239105170.html WebHow Dijkstra's Algorithm works. Dijkstra's Algorithm works on the basis that any subpath B -> D of the shortest path A -> D between vertices A and D is also the shortest path between vertices B and D. Each subpath is …

Dijkstra algorithm js

Did you know?

WebJun 15, 2024 · Dijkstra's algorithm is an algorithm for finding the shortest paths between nodes in a weighted graph. We'll use the new addEdge and addDirectedEdge methods … WebSep 28, 2024 · Dijkstra's Algorithm basically starts at the node that you choose (the source node) and it analyzes the graph to find the shortest path between that node and all the …

WebJun 17, 2024 · Use DFS to reach the adjacent vertices 5. Assign the neighbors a different color (1 - current color) 6. Repeat steps 3 to 5 as long as it satisfies the two-colored constraint 7. If a neighbor has the same color as the …

WebOct 15, 2024 · My doubt isn't in the Algorithm, it's in the js code. So, in this line of code when, let edge = graph[mn][j]; ... Dijkstra's algorithm - JavaScript implementation. 1. Having issues with Djikstra's algorithm. 0. Can anybody please describe this portion of code of the Dijkstra algorithm. 1. WebApr 11, 2024 · Finding the Shortest Path in Javascript: Dijkstra’s Algorithm Find a path between two nodes in a graph such that the sum of the weights of its constituent edges is …

WebAug 5, 2024 · The Bellman–Ford algorithm is an algorithm that computes shortest paths from a single source vertex to all of the other vertices in a weighted digraph. It uses 2 for loop, what makes time complexity Vertex * Edges in worst cases. Time Complexity: O (VE) Graph type: negative or positive weighted DAG. function bellmanFord(graph, vertex) { …

WebAlgorithm 修改Dijsktra';使用具有多个可能代价的边的s算法 algorithm graph 我需要使用Dijkstra算法的时间依赖变量,它可以处理从一个节点到另一个节点的两种可能方式,节点之间的成本(边缘成本)取决于我们到达源节点的时间和我们将要使用的边缘类型。 mini four catalyseWebAug 19, 2024 · Dijkstra’s Algorithm can find paths to all locations; A* finds paths to one location. It prioritizes paths that seem to be leading closer to a goal. ... Below is the App.js component which is ... mini four darty moulinexWebAt first, this list will contain the source node only. The algorithm starts from the source node, which in this case is A. We change the distances of nodes B and C in the distance list to be 5 and 2. As the sum of distance value from source node to nodes B and C is greater than the original distance, they are changed. mini four chez boulanger electromenagerWebJan 24, 2024 · I found a partial example in this link - How to highlight the path between two nodes in CYTOSCAPE JS. The code in above link uses Dijkstra's algorithm to find the shortest path. But I need the actual path taken, as given in … mini four cuisinart tob175beWebNov 2, 2024 · Star 16. Code. Issues. Pull requests. Silk Road Graph Analyzer is an application in which you can draw you desired graph with arbitrary IDs and numbers, and solve Shortest Path and Traveling Sales Person problems. graph-algorithms tsp-problem dijkstra-shortest-path shortestpath antcolony. Updated on Feb 7, 2024. Java. most popular chicken breeds in the usWebJul 30, 2016 · Dijkstra's algorithm - JavaScript implementation. There are three nodes: a,b,c. I interpret a: {b:3,c:1}, as follows. The cost form a to b is 3. Then b: {a:2,c:1} is the … mini four conforamaWebJan 10, 2024 · Dijkstra's algorithm is an algorithm that is used to solve the shortest distance problem. That is, we use it to find the shortest distance between two vertices on … most popular chicken thigh recipes